#585769 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#585769 is composed of 34.5% red, 34.1%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.2% cyan, 17.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 243.3 degrees, a saturation of 9.4% and a lightness of 37.6%. #585769 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0aed2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#585769 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#585769 has RGB values of R:88, G:87,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 5789545.
